The Journey from Marrakech to Ouzoud

The trip starts early, typically with a pick-up from your hotel or riad in Marrakech. The minibus is air-conditioned, which is a relief given Morocco’s warm climate, especially in summer. The drive to the waterfalls takes approximately 3 to 4 hours, depending on traffic and stops.

Along the way, you’ll pass through the Grand Atlas villages and see traditional Berber towns, which add a cultural touch to the journey. The scenery offers a comforting mix of olive groves and rugged mountains, giving you a taste of rural Morocco away from the bustling city.

Some reviews mention that the car trip can be longer than the actual visit—a common experience with day trips—so be prepared for a fair amount of time on the road. The upside? The scenery is often described as beautiful, especially as you get closer to the waterfalls.

Arrival at Ouzoud Waterfalls

Once at the site, you’ll have around 4 hours to explore. The Ouzoud Waterfalls are renowned for their impressive height and the uninterrupted views of the cascading torrents. The sight of water tumbling down multiple tiers into a deep pool is truly a picture-perfect moment.

Many travelers comment on how spectacular the waterfalls are. The sound of rushing water, the mist in the air, and the lush greenery make it a refreshing escape. You’re free to wander along the well-marked paths, and the site is large enough to find your own quiet spot for photos or a leisurely break.

Activities at the Waterfalls

Beyond simply admiring the views, there are activities to enhance your visit. Many guests choose to take a swim in the crystal-clear waters—just be cautious of slippery rocks. For an extra thrill, you can upgrade to an optional boat ride, which offers a different perspective of the waterfalls from the water level.

The boat ride is a well-loved addition, giving an up-close view of the cascades and the surrounding cliffs. Travelers often describe it as a peaceful, scenic experience, though it is optional and comes with an additional cost.

Lunch and Local Cuisine

Around the waterfalls, you’ll find small local restaurants serving traditional Moroccan dishes like Tajine. Many reviews emphasize the authenticity and flavor of the food, making it a worthwhile part of the day. The restaurants are simple but welcoming, and you’ll get a chance to enjoy Moroccan hospitality and cuisine with views of the waterfalls.

Returning to Marrakech

After a relaxed afternoon, the return journey starts around 3 pm, aiming to arrive back in Marrakech by 7 pm. The return trip is often quicker, but some guests mention that traffic can cause delays. The overall experience wraps up with a good sense of having escaped to nature while being comfortably transported back to the city.
